Definitions:

Export Subsidies

Financial support from the government to companies for the purpose of encouraging exports of goods to foreign countries.

Agricultural Products

Goods derived from farming and agriculture, including food items, feed, fiber, and biofuel commodities.

Tariffs

Taxes imposed by a government on imported or occasionally exported goods, often used to protect domestic industries from foreign competition.

Agricultural Act of 2014

A comprehensive statute that governs United States federal farm programs including crop insurance, conservation programs, and nutritional assistance.
